Default CAT Parked all Aircraft (Jet Univ now CRJ200)

Or so that is what I have been told. Jet Univ is now saying they have made agreements with Pinnacle to do CRJ200 training with a 3 month training schedule and then HAVE a job as FO. Airline is paying some of the training ($5K of $32K) and they say making more then $20/hr after training.

Personally, I think it's a load of crap. Talk from some of the check airman, and they aren't too happy either. I'm already tired of being lumped in with GIA as it is, now I gotta deal with this, too.

There are WAY too many qualified applicants out there for us to be stooping to this. The problem is, a lot of those qualified applicants don't want to work for $21/hr and only a $3/hr raise the second year. HOPEFULLY, we can wake the company the F up and get them to realize the reason so many FOs are bailing (thus costing them oney training replacements) is b/c of the low pay.
